Porcello pitches 4 scoreless, Tigers beat Rays 9-6

LAKELAND, Fla. (AP) — Rick Porcello pitched four scoreless innings and rookie Austin Jackson tripled twice as Detroit beat Tampa Bay 9-6 on Sunday.

Porcello, a 21-year-old right-hander who won 14 games in 2009 as a rookie, has yet to allow a run in nine exhibition innings. On Sunday, he faced 15 batters, giving up two hits while striking out one and walking two in an efficient effort.

Jackson, who started in center, was 3-for-4 with three runs.

Rays starter Jeff Niemann also pitched well. He allowed three hits and one earned run in 3 2-3 innings.

Catcher John Jaso and outfielders Sean Rodriguez and Justin Ruggiano homered for Tampa Bay.
